B.A. (Hons.) – Visual Arts – Animation & VFX

Curriculum
1stYear (2D Animation) | Drawing & Color Design Pre-Production: 2D character Design, Background Design, Story Board Design, Layout Design 2D Animation: Key Frame Animation, Sequential Drawing, 2D Character Animation, Post Production |
2ndYear (3DAnimation) | Character and clay Modeling, Polygon Modeling, texturing, lighting, rendering |
3rdYear | VFX, Rigging, 3D animation, compositing, Project work / Thesis (Internship based on organization facilitations) |

Animation is nothing but creating life to the creators/organic objects there are many forms animation from the past decade its starts from Traditional Animation to the latest motioncapture as mention blower There are different kinds of techniques to create animation.
Traditional Animation– In this technique you use series/sequential photographs of drawings drawn on paper with pen or pencil
Stop Motion Animation– It is created by physically manipulation of real world objects and photographing each frame of film.
Computer Animation – Computer Animation are of two types 2D and 3D. In 2D bit graphics however 3D graphics is created a 3D polygon mesh.
Motion capture– It is the technique of capturing the realtime Actions/Motions from the live actors to the 3d interpreted characters/Objects.
